This position isresponsible for the coordination of self-tracers, and for conducting process tracers including developing tracers,collecting, analyzing, and reporting tracer findings. This Coordinator uses their clinical expertise to advise andsuccessfully collaborate with various levels of personnel including leaders, physicians, and team members.Core Responsibilities and Essential Functions:Maintains current knowledge of requirements related to CMS Conditions of Participation, The JointCommission, the Georgia Department of Public Health, and other governing bodies. Interprets regulations,licensure standards, and accreditation standards with an emphasis on the hospital, laboratory, andambulatory care expectations.Develops and delivers education regarding internally and externally driven trends in healthcare licensure,accreditation, and regulatory compliance. Assists managers and staff with workflow development, policyand procedure review/revision, mock survey assessments, and continuing education.Works in conjunction with the Manager as well as hospital and clinic leaders, medical staff, and allied healthstaff to identify, prioritize and mitigate accreditation and regulatory compliance risks and opportunities.Partners with operational leaders and departments to develop corrective action plans and to track thesuccess of corrective action plans.Uses clinical expertise to conduct tracers and audits of documentation and processes. Assists clinicians inimproving processes and compliance to regulatory standards.Gathers and submits necessary documents to support the maintenance of and changes to accreditationapplication. Provides support to Manager and Director during pre-survey preparation, on-site survey, andpost-survey follow up activities.Performs other duties as assignedComplies with all Wellstar Health System policies, standards of work, and code of conduct.Required Minimum Education:Associates Nursing or Bachelors Nursing-PreferredRequired Minimum License(s) and Certification(s):All certifications are required upon hire unless otherwise stated.RN-Compact or RN - Reg Nurse (Single State)Additional License(s) and Certification(s):CPHQ Preferred.Required Minimum Experience:Minimum 2 years Acute care setting as a clinician/registered nurse. Required orMinimum 5 years Acute care setting as a clinician/registered nurse. PreferredRequired Minimum Skills:Computer skills required to include MicrosoftWord, Excel and PowerPoint, DataAbstraction and Management.
